Made from the "Burgundy Clones" this Chardonnay has a distinctive melon fruit spectrum with complexity and texture gained from a wild yeast fermentation and extended lees contact. It is fresh but not austere, textured but not buttery.

Vintage 2018
91 points THE REAL REVIEW
Faint exotic tropical fruit plus a touch of oatmeal and fresh cream. The palate has lovely weight and texture with subtle honeydew melon flavours. An extremely well-made wine with subtlety and composure. Ensure you use a large glass to watch the layers unfurl
